Introductory circuits (基础电路理论)
发布日期:2009-04-02  浏览

【内容简介】
The book begins with circuit design, electrical variables (including an overview on DC circuits) and circuit laws and equivalence. Exercises, problems and more challenging problems are presented to help consolidate learning. Spence approaches circuit analysis by showing the similarity between the equations describing AC,DC, and small-nonlinear behaviour. He instructs how to handle Zener diodes in power supplies and opamps in switching circuits, describing stabilization of voltage and the laws governing change behaviour. An overview of the analysis of change is presented near the end of the book, with a full explanation of small changes in nonlinear circuits, with systematic analysis. Comprehensive textbook covering the essentials in circuit analysis, laws, design and behaviour, offering worked problems and solutions. Contains only the basic and most important information on electrical engineering for 'non-EE' students Includes phasor diagrams and a clear description of complex currents and voltages. Good number of worked exercises at three levels of difficulty, with solutions Clear structure with consistent treatment of resistive, reactive and small-signal operation
